Sargan Kerimov

Sargan Kerimov

  • Country of origin: Azerbaijan
  • Current residence: Azerbaijan

Sargan is studying Political Science and International Relations at the Qərbi Kaspi Universiteti (Western Caspian University). Being an active participant of many different volunteering experiences, such as Association Internationale des Étudiants en Sciences Économiques et Commerciales (AIESEC) and Euroschool, he has shown that he is a highly motivated and enthusiastic student with a strong interest in European integration and the development of bilateral cooperation. Sargan considers himself a friendly and helpful individual when it comes to assisting colleagues and other people asking for help. Driven by his interests, he works diligently to accomplish measurable impact in his community, while gathering experience for his future diplomatic career.
